Course Description:
This training module was developed by the Michigan Developmental Disabilities Institute housed at Wayne State University for Direct Support Professionals who are seeking information and skills regarding self-determination and how it is applied to individuals with Intellectual/Developmental Disabilities.
Course Objectives:
By the end of this training you should:
1. Know the Individual Budget Tools
2. Be Familiar with the 3 Characteristics of Self-Determination
3. Know the 5 Principles of Self-Determination
4. Be able to apply the idea of Self-Determination to your own life and support it within the lives of those around you
